  • Q: What is the goal of AcidSpider?
    A: The goal of AcidSpider is to move all 104 cards to the eight home cells in the upper right of the playfield.

    Group cards by suit, in descending order (King through Ace). Once you've made a complete stack of cards, King through Ace, the cards can move to a home cell. Individual cards can't move to the home cells on their own. There are 104 cards in AcidSpider - more that one deck.

    AcidSpider includes a quick step-by-step demo that will show you how to play. Select "Show me how to play" from the main menu.

  • Q: Are all games winnable?
    A: All games in AcidSpider are winnable. They may not be easy, but they can be won. If you've got one you think is unwinnable, let us know and we'll post the game number to see if anyone can get it.

  • Q: What are Sparkle HintsTM?
    A: Sparkle Hints, one part of the IntelliMoveTM system, highlight the best possible moves. Cycle through all the Sparkle Hints until you find a move you like. You can use your 5-way navigator to view all Sparkle Hints or request a Sparkle Hint from the drop down menu.

  • Q: What is EZ PlayTM?
    A: EZ Play is intuitive, single handed game play using your 5-way navigator. Press left or right on the 5-way navigator to show possible moves. Press the center to move selected cards. Press up to undo moves. Press down to request a Sparkle Hint.

  • Q: Some of the cool visual effects aren't working for me.
    A: Many cool features, like JPEG backgrounds and translucent cards, are only available on handhelds with Palm OS 5 or higher. Older handhelds don't have enough processing power to handle the new features, but the game still works great (and fast) on older devices with Palm OS 4 or earlier.

  • Q: Can I make my own backgrounds for AcidSpider?
    A: JPEG images on your memory card or stored in RAM can be used as backgrounds. You can install JPEGs onto your memory card using the Palm Install Tool or Quick Install.

    Once the JPEGs are on your memory card AcidSpider will find them and make them available as a background.

    JPEGs will automatically be scaled to fill the screen. If a background image is very tall or very wide, some of the image will be cropped off. You can resize the image to fit the screen better using image editing software if you like. If the image is small (less than 2/3 the size of the screen), it will be tiled instead of scaled up to fit the screen.

    If your handheld has a built-in camera, you can take a picture of anything and use it as a background. Just save the picture from your camera, start-up AcidSpider and select the picture from the "Select Background..." dialog box.

    Note that JPEG background support is only available on handhelds with Palm OS 5 or higher and a color screen.
